Initial experience with #PSP games on the #RetroidPocket5 is mostly good! BurnOut runs with some stuttering. I can probably tweak some settings to get it to a steady FPS. #PPSSPP crashed and caused #Rocknix to reboot once, and I can't find a way to run it as a #libretro core so that Auto-Saves work consistently. I'm hopeful that those details can get worked out.
I got #Rocknix installed on my #RetroidPocket5. But it's #PSP emulator doesn't accept .7z files so I've got to decompress my whole collection and convert them to .chd files. Also, the Dreamcast .chd files I built from redumped bin+cues aren't compatible with #FlyCast so I've got to convert all of those to .gdi then re-chd them.
